Packing your TNF backpack correctly can be the secret to a memorable outdoor expedition. Whether you're hitting a day hike or a multi-day trek, adhering these tips will make certain you've got everything you need.
Firstly, take an inventory of your supplies.
Make a list of what's required for your particular activity. This will help you stay clear of overpacking, which can weigh you on the trail.
Secondly, arrange your items by type.
* Attire: Layer your clothes to accommodate changing weather conditions. Pack sweat-absorbing base layers, a fleece, and a waterproof outer shell.
* Gear: Carry your vital gear such as a first aid kit, a compass, a flashlight, and a pocket tool.
* {Food and Water|: This is vital. Pack granola bars and plenty of water. Consider using a water filter to make certain you have access to clean drinking water.
Last but not least, pack your bag efficiently. Balance the weight evenly and keep the heaviest items closest to your center of gravity. Use compression straps to reduce bulk.

From Day Trips to Treks: Mastering North Face Backpack Organization
Whether you're embarking on a quick day trip or planning an epic adventure, your North Face backpack is your trusty companion. But a haphazardly packed bag can quickly turn into a frustrating experience. Mastering the art of organization is key to enjoying your outdoor pursuits, and with a few simple strategies, you can transform your North Face backpack from a chaotic mess into a well-oiled machine. Start by dividing your gear into essential categories: clothing, electronics, first aid, food, and tools. Inside each category, use compressible bags to further contain items. This not only maximizes space but also makes it easier to locate what you need when you need it here most.
Don't forget to harness the specialized pockets and compartments that your North Face backpack offers. These can be reserved to specific items like water bottles, sunglasses, or maps. By strategically packing your gear, you'll be well-prepared for any adventure that comes your way.
